The letter to Senor Nobody had given explicit enough direction.

Clear of all buildings, he drew rein and took bearings.

Here was the stream, the stump of a burned mill, the mountain-going road, narrower and rougher than the way of main travel.

He followed this road; the horses fell into a plodding deliberateness of pace.

The sunshine streamed warm around, but there was little human life here to feel its rays.
